John D. T. McAllister letter

 File — Folder 1: [Barcode: 31197230313527]
Identifier: MSS SC 1620
Scope and Contents

Handwritten and signed letter by John Daniel Thompson McAllister dated 1901 addressed to a stake president in the Manti region. This letter is a request to admonish the members of that stake to be generous with their donations so the costs of operating the temple could be covered.

Dates: 1901

Mormon temple, Manti Utah

 Item — Oversize-folder 1: [Barcode: 31197239280586]
Identifier: MSS 9234
Scope and Contents

A black-and-white gelatin silver photograph titled, "Mormon Temple, Manti Utah" by Ansel Adams. The back of the photograph identifies it as "Print no. 4 of set no. 24 of Portfolio One by Ansel Adams, 1948."

Dates: 1948
